Asus MOBO

Say , does any know if it's possible to use the raid set up the comes with the P4P800 MOBO with Fc2. this is my current set up : two western digital 36 gig raptor S-ata HDD,one WD 120 gig cavier HDD and one 40 gig WD HDD, the MOBO is a P4P800, the raid controller is a ICH5R with the PE865, also is it possible to use a Lexmark X1100 printer, I can't get mine working . any info will deeply appreciated.

UGH! good luck trying to even run redhat on a p4p800......i have a p4p800 deluxe mobo and i dont even think ya can get it to load.... there is a bug against that mobo that it will just keep rebooting during the first part of the install....i can vouch for this problem it happened to me... try suse is my suggestion instead.......... suse should pick up the raid controller it picked up mine if i remember right....as far as the printer goes...dunno
